The Presidents Cup

After many rounds of the Presidents Cup only 4 teams remained and they would do battle over Puckrup Hall on Sunday 8th October looking to be crowned Champions. The Semi final match ups were Ross-on-Wye GC v Players Club and Minchinhampton v Lilley Brook. With the weather unseasonally warm and the golf course looking great, things were set up perfectly.

Semi Finals

Ross-on-Wye GC v Players Club

Minchinhampton v Lilley Brook.

Ross-on-Wye were victorious is their semi final by the margin of 3-2 and in the other semi final Minchinhampton beat Lilley Brook on the last green, 3-2. This set up a final between Ross-on-Wye v Minchinhampton. Battling it out for in the 3rd place play off would be Lilley Brook GC and The Players GC. 

3rd Place Play Off

Lilley Brook v Players

Following in a similar suit to the semi final matches the 3rd place play off would be prove to be a tight affair but Lilley Brook edged it 3-2 giving them 3rd place.

Final

Ross-on-Wye v Minchinhampton

After winning the first 2 matches out the trophy looked to be heading to Minchinhampton but a very good fightback from the final 3 Ross-on-Wye pairs ensured that the trophy would be heading their way. The final score being a 3-2 win for Ross-on-Wye. Congratulations to the team and to Captain Neil Lancett.

 

The final standings were:

1st Ross-on-Wye  GC

2nd Minchinhampton GC

3rd Lilley Brook GC

4th The Players GC
